SYMSYS 195N

Natural Language Processing with Deep Learning (CS 224N, LINGUIST 284)

UNITS:3-4
GRADING:Letter or Credit/No Credit
LEVEL:Undergrad
GER:—

Methods for processing human language information and the underlying computational properties of natural languages. Focus on deep learning approaches: understanding, implementing, training, debugging, visualizing, and extending neural network models for a variety of language understanding tasks. Exploration of natural language tasks ranging from simple word level and syntactic processing to coreference, question answering, and machine translation. Examination of representative papers and systems and completion of a final project applying a complex neural network model to a large-scale NLP problem. Prerequisites: calculus and linear algebra; CS 124, CS 221, or CS 229.
